To seize theseopportunities, even themost traditionalmanufacturingbusinesses must initiate systems and foster corporate cultures conducive to digital innovation. This isnot justaboutcodingorsystemdesignskills; rather, this transitionrequiresan understanding of how digital natives live. Most digital natives are millennials or youngerpeople,whoarebornafter1982.This isnot to say thatolderpeoplecannot drive digital innovation—manycan; however, the volumeof talent required todeal with the speed of contemporary digital transformationmeans that evenmid-sized companies must recruit, motivate, and retain many young digital intrapreneurs. Digitalnativesunderstandthewaysinwhichemergingtechnologycanbe,andis,used (Rossi 2019). What are digital natives looking for? Deloitte (2019) has recently conducted another roundof their ‘Millennials Survey’ and suggested thatmillennials have the following expectations: 1. Work that is alignedwith their sense of purpose 2. A chance tomake a significant contribution before they are 50 3. Freedom to choosewhat projects towork on 4. Freedom to act andmake decisions about their workwithout frustrating delays caused bywaiting for permission 5. Work that aligns with a desire to make the world better, as well as producing profit. These demands do not fit well with command-and-control management approaches or shareholder-value-only objectives. However, these demands do not come from an unreasonable sense of entitlement by the young. They are what employees need to get the digital innovations and the other increasingly creative, intrinsicallymotivated and self-guidedwork of the twenty-first century done. Older managers, not realising that the nature of work is changing, might think that the demands of the young are absurd; however, most talented digital natives will stay inanunsupportivecompanyforonlyas longas it takes toestablishagood résuméentryand then leave towork for another employerwhowill bemorewilling to accommodate their needs. Many older managers find it frustrating to manage these youngpeople,whodonot seem tobehave ‘theway the employees ought to’.
